Output 111b89315091505c2ab8c9df1e889ff95ff5a01862421379e9b7e8c419550c5b:5

value
2810263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9703d6ba0929ba9f663f7303f823802bcfe17538 OP_EQUAL
address
3FTWZEU3EHXZFF55f6M9k2NHj9xH5KtJ5o
transaction
111b89315091505c2ab8c9df1e889ff95ff5a01862421379e9b7e8c419550c5b
spent
true